STACK Infrastructure is seeking a Procurement Manager to support procurement activity across major EMEA data centre developments and operational infrastructure projects. This role is responsible for leading sourcing activities for capital equipment, installation services and maintenance support across mission‑critical environments. Working closely with Delivery, Engineering, Operations and supplier partners, you will help drive commercial performance, supplier capability and project execution across complex infrastructure programmes. This is an opportunity to join a fast‑growing global business delivering large‑scale digital infrastructure projects across EMEA.
Key Responsibilities
- Support CAPEX & OPEX category leads with sourcing and procurement activities for OFCI equipment and repair & maintenance services across EMEA.
- Support RFx processes, supplier evaluations and commercial recommendations.
- Partner with Engineering, Operations and Delivery teams to ensure technical and commercial alignment.
- Drive supplier performance, cost efficiency and delivery compliance across procurement programmes.
- Track procurement milestones, purchase orders and delivery schedules aligned to project timelines.
- Support supplier relationship management through KPI monitoring and business reviews.
- Collaborate with Operations teams to ensure appropriate long‑term equipment support and service continuity.
- Drive expediting tracking processes from order to equipment delivery on site, to ensure schedule conformance for OFCI purchases across our EMEA construction projects.
Skills & Experience
- Demonstrable experience managing procurement and sourcing activities within construction, engineering or critical infrastructure environments.
- Strong commercial, supplier management and stakeholder engagement capability.
- Experience managing RFx processes, bid analysis and supplier negotiations.
- Excellent communication, organisation and problem‑solving skills.
- Experience within data centres, mission‑critical infrastructure or OFCI procurement environments is advantageous.
